پروژه گرافیک کامپیوتری دوبعدی چرخش گل آفتاب گردان با زبان برنامه نویسی پلاس پلاس و در محیط کامپایلر ویژوال استدیو و با استفاده از کتابخانه گرافیکی opengl برای دانشجویان رشته کامپیوتر طراحی و کد نویسی شده است.
در این برنامه یک گل آفتابگردان با چهره خندان در دشت سرسبز وجود دارد که یک پروانه دور آن در حال پرواز است، همچنین در آسمان خورشید تابان و ابرهای متحرک در حال حرکت هستند.
کاربر می تواند با استفاده از کلیک چپ موس باعث حرکت برگهای گل آفتابگردان به سمت بالا و پایین، و با کلیک راست موس باعث چرخش گلبرگهای گل آفتابگردان شود.
ابرها در آسمان از سمتی به سمتی دیگر به صورت اتوماتیک در حال حرکت هستند و به محض خارج شدن از یک سمت صفحه نمایش از سمت دیگر ظاهر می شوند. خورشید هم در حال نورافشانی و تابیدن می باشد.
توابع پرکاربد در این پروژه:
-
glTranslatef تغییر مختصات نمایش اشیاء و عناصر موجود در صحنه
-
glBegin(GL_POLYGON) رسم چند ضلعی
-
glBegin(GL_QUADS) رسم چهار ضلعی
-
gluDisk تابع رسم دایره و دیسک تو خالی
-
glBegin(GL_LINES) رسم خطوط
تکنیک های مورد استفاده:
-
حرکت (x,y) عناصر موجود در برنامه
-
استفاده از کلیک راست و چپ موس
-
رسم اشکال هندسی ساده
-
دوران اشیاء
لازم به توضیح است که داخل سورس برنامه جهت خوانایی بیشتر آن، توضیحاتی خط به خط در قالب کامنت فینگلیش قرار داده شده است.
عنوان : پروژه متحرک گرافیک کامپیوتری اپن جی ال آفتابگردان و پروانه
بازدید : 8752 نفر
قیمت : 39,000 تومان
کد فایل : 259
فرمت : EXE , CPP
حجم فایل : 1,544 مگابایت
در صورت پولی بودن پروژه لینک دانلود فایل پس از پرداخت هزینه پروژه برای شما نشان داده می شود.
پروژه متحرک گرافیک اپن جی ال -
برنامه آفتابگردان و پروانه در opengl -
دانلود سورس برنامه متحرک در اوپن جی ال